Standard Queen Mattress Dimensions
The standard Queen bed size in Australia is:
153 cm (W) × 203 cm (L)
That’s about 60 inches × 80 inches in imperial measurements.
So if you’ve ever wondered “what is the size of a Queen bed?” or “what dimensions is Queen bed?”, that’s your answer.
- Width: 153 cm
- Length: 203 cm
- Ideal Room Size: At least 3 m × 3 m
This size balances bedroom flow and comfort. You can still fit bedside tables, a dresser, and have space to walk around.

Australia Mattress Size Comparison Guide
If you’re torn between sizes, here’s how they stack up 👇
Mattress Size |
Dimensions (cm) |
Best For |
Single |
92 × 188 |
Kids, small rooms |
King Single |
107 × 203 |
Teens, tall singles |
Double |
138 × 188 |
Solo adults |
Queen |
153 × 203 |
Couples, main bedrooms |
King |
183 × 203 |
Couples wanting more space |
Super King |
203 × 203 |
Large master suites |
A quick glance shows:
- Queen vs King: 30 cm narrower → fits more rooms
- Queen vs Double: 15 cm wider → noticeably comfier for two
So when choosing between King size mattress dimensions vs Queen, think room size first.
Choosing the Right Queen Mattress for You
A bed’s not just about size—it’s about feel.
Here’s what to consider before you click “add to cart”:
Mattress Type
- Memory Foam: Hugs your body, great motion isolation
- Hybrid: Springs + foam = bounce with comfort
- Innerspring: Classic support, cooler airflow
- Latex: Naturally hypoallergenic, durable
Firmness
- Soft: Side sleepers who want cushioning
- Medium: All-round comfort, suits most couples
- Firm: Back/stomach sleepers or heavier builds
Extra Features
- Cooling layers for hot nights
- Edge support for full-surface use
- Zoned support for better spinal alignment
Tip: Match firmness to your sleeping position—your back will thank you.

FAQs
What are the dimensions of a queen size mattress?
The standard Queen bed dimensions in Australia are 153 cm × 203 cm
What’s the length of a Queen bed?
All Australian Queens measure 203 cm long, same as a King.
What’s the difference between King and Queen size?
A King is 183 cm wide, 30 cm wider than a Queen. Length stays the same.
Will a Queen bed fit in my room?
Ideally, your bedroom should be at least 3 m × 3 m to allow space for side tables and movement.
Are Queen mattresses good for tall people?
Yes. At 203 cm long, it suits most sleepers under 6’6”.
